  2. You do not have to seal your driveway every year. Most homeowners seal their driveway once every three to ten years. However, you may not want to believe what other people say because you are the first person who determines the condition of your driveway. If you feel that your driveway needed to be sealed again anytime soon, go on. If you think that it is still in pretty shape, leave it that way. The sealant will last depending on the weather condition in your area. You can leave your driveway alone for three years if you live in a place with moderate weather condition. In case you live in a place where the temperature reaches up to 100 degrees in summer, receives a great deal of rain or snow, resealing it is required every other year.
